Output 587de56153152ddac7fce6e84fbed0a275326c0e180ece16fa444406b2bca330:0

value
25947156
script pubkey
OP_0 OP_PUSHBYTES_20 30d3ee4c3f65a3c6be5e4291fce04b19ab79d360
address
ltc1qxrf7unplvk3ud0j7g2glecztrx4hn5mqpcuhjv
transaction
587de56153152ddac7fce6e84fbed0a275326c0e180ece16fa444406b2bca330
spent
true